While You Were Sleeping
on DVD
(1995)
Starring: Sandra Bullock, Bill Pullman, Peter Gallagher
Director: Jon Turteltaub
Certificate: 
When a lonely subway toll-taker is mistaken for a comatose man's fiancee after saving his life, his estranged family welcomes her with open arms. But when a brother becomes suspicious and investigates her claims, she realizes she's "attached" to the wrong brother!

The Holiday
on DVD
(2006)
Starring: Cameron Diaz, Kate Winslet, Jude Law
Director: Nancy Meyers
Certificate: 
Two women troubled with guy-problems (Diaz, Winslet) swap homes in each other's countries, where they each meet a local guy and fall in love.
